Output 8e50434f6987ff9d0f70d7f528ad6681c4441a8b2d85924d4a6bfe9f87eab19f:3

value
7681180497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41009ef3b6be75eafd4557b197da4a32afa1c9e4 OP_EQUAL
address
37cib9tVkmk8iB9A1ojLFQLGicc6UpipS3
transaction
8e50434f6987ff9d0f70d7f528ad6681c4441a8b2d85924d4a6bfe9f87eab19f
spent
true